A crazy, noisy twist on a favourite rhyme in a split-page novelty format.


There were ten in the bed and the speckled hen said, "Roll over! Roll over!". . .

Bedtime is fun time for the funny animal characters in this hilarious split-page picture book. As each animal noisily tumbles out, one by one, their bed gets emptier and the mayhem in the rest of the room gets crazier. Will anyone ever get any sleep?!

Katrina Charman (Author) Katrina has spent her life surrounded by books ever since her first visit to the library when she was tiny. She now lives in a house full of bookshelves fit to bursting, and continues to fill them with books that she has written. She recently won Booktrust's Story Time prize for her and Nick Sharratt's picture book The Whales on the Bus. When she's not writing for children, she is cuddled up with one of her fluffy cats and a good book, or plucking cat hairs off her clothes. Guilherme Karsten (Illustrator) Guilherme lives in Blumenau, in southern Brazil. In 2010, he won a national contest for new children's book illustrators and has been working with editorial illustrations ever since. After illustrating many books for other authors, Guilherme started writing his own books in 2017. Guilherme's work has been published worldwide and has received various accolades, including the Jabuti Award and the Golden Pinwheel Grand Award. Guilherme continues to seek ways to entertain and delight children through his art and stories.
